Punjab and Haryana High Court Bar Council requests physical hearings to be started as early as possible

By Saakshi S. Rawat      20 August, 2021 04:23 PM      0 Comments
Punjab and Haryana hc Bar Council requests physical hearings

The Punjab and Haryana High Court Bar Association has petitioned the Punjab and Haryana High Court to start physical hearings in the High Court such that pendency can be alleviated to a certain degree and plaintiffs who are awaiting hearings can receive justice.

The Bar Association also attached an assessment form wherein the majority of its members are in support of actual reopening of the courts, despite the fact that, as of 16.08.2021, just two cases were being recorded and the number of affected cases has been decreased to 43 in Chandigarh.

The Bar Council also stated that they have organised 39 vaccination campaigns and vaccinated 8005 members, their households, and other people associated with the High Court, such as merchants, HCBA staff, and AG Office staff, to date.

As a result, the Bar Council respectfully requested that the physical session be restarted as soon as possible.
